    1. Hocking Family of Edwards County, Illinois
    2. This is a Message Board Post that is gatewayed to this mailing list. Surnames: Hocking, Lough, Nading, Gibson, Fishel, Hoeszel, Price, Attebery Classification: Query Message Board URL: http://boards.ancestry.com/mbexec/msg/rw/TSj.2ACIB/131 Message Board Post: HOCKING FAMILY OF Bone Gap, Edwards County, Illinois Richard HOCKING was born in 1813 at Cornwall, England. He died 16 Apr 1871 at Bone Gap, Edwards County, Illinois. He married Charity Temperance (went by Temperance) LOUGH on 22 Jul 1841 at Edwards County, Illinois. Temperance was born 06 Feb 1825 at present-day West Virginia and died 16 Jul 1898 at Bone Gap, Edwards County, Illinois. Temperance was the fourth of fifteen known children of Prudence Gibson (born 17 Apr 1800 at Virginia and died 02 Sep 1883 at Richland County, Illinois) who married the Rev. Peter LOUGH (b. 03 Feb 1792 at Pendleton County, present-day West Virginia and died 26 Apr 1860 at Pixley Township, Clay County, Illinois) on 25 Dec 1815 in Virginia. Prudence and Peter are buried at the Wesley Cemetery near Passport, in Clay County, Illinois. The family came west to Edwards County, Illinois along with Prudence's parents in 1837. They moved to Clay County, Illinois in 1844. Peter's father fought in the Revolutionary War. Temperance and Richard Hockin! g are buried at the Bone Gap Cemetery, Bone Gap, Edwards County, Illinois. Temperance and Richard HOCKING were the parents of eleven known children: 1. Henry HOCKING (20 May 1842 - 02 May 1856) 2. Warren HOCKING (22 Dec 1843 - 04 Jan 1916) 3. Peter HOCKING (1846-???) 4. Robert C. HOCKING (1847-???) 5. Susanna C. HOCKING (03 Dec 1849-03 Jul 1922) 6. Mary Jane HOCKING (23 Jul 1851-14 Dec 1856) 7. Ruann HOCKING (04 Dec 1852-24 Jul 1914) 8. Charles Marcelous HOCKING (May 1856 - after 1920) 9. Martha Loverna HOCKING (1858-24 Jan 1922) 10. Prudence M. HOCKING (1862-???) 11. Ansel A. HOCKING (1866-???) We continue with the son Charles Marcelous (Marcellus?) HOCKING: Charles Marcelous HOCKING was born May 1856 at Illinois and died after 1920 at Corning, Clay County, Arkansas. He married Eliza Eumestina Lucresta (or Eliza Ernistina?) NADING on 16 Dec 1877 at Bone Gap, Edwards County, Illinois. Eliza was born 22 Feb 1856 at Davidson County, North Carolina and died 23 Apr 1936 (in Arkansas?). Eliza was the second of six known children of Matthew NADING (born 12 Feb 1827 at Friedberg, Stokes County, North Carolina and died 17 Sep 1865 in North Carolina) who married Mary Ann FISHEL (born 14 Feb 1834 at Stokes County, North Carolina and died 23 Sep 1890 at Edwards County, Illinois) on 06 Apr 1852 at Forsyth County, North Carolina. Matthew NADING is buried at the Hebron Reformed Church Cemetery, on the Forsyth-Davidson County Border, North Carolina. Mary Ann FISHEL NADING HOESZEL is buried at the West Salem Moravian Church graveyard. Mrs. Mary Ann NADING married William J. HOESZEL (08 Sep 1839 - 06 Feb 1916) on 11 Mar 1869 at Edwards County, Illinois. Charles Marcelous HOCKING and Eliza NADING HOCKING were the parents of nine known children: 1. Edson Cook HOCKING (04 Aug 1878 - ???). Did he die young? or is he mixed up with his cousin Edson Cook HOCKING, son of Daniel HOCKING? 2. Ira HOCKING (03 Jan 1880 - ???), born at Bone Gap, nothing known. 3. Richard HOCKING (18 Jan 1881 - ???), born at Bone Gap, nothing known. 4. Wilbur HOCKING (26 Dec 1883 - ???), born at Bone Gap, nothing known, living with parents in 1920. 5. Everett HOCKING (05 Dec 1885 - ???), born at Bone Gap, married Buena PRICE, at least four children: Leo, Frank, George and Lorine Gladys; family lived at Sangamon County, Illinois in 1920. 6. Parley L. HOCKING (23 Jun 1888 - ???), born at Bone Gap, nothing known. 7. Loren HOCKING (01 Feb 1890 - ???), born at Bone Gap, married Maggie, lived in Clay County, Arkansas in 1920 8. Lavina HOCKING (26 Aug 1891 - ???), born at Bone Gap, married William Oscar ATTEBERY. 9. Mary HOCKING (04 May 1895 - ???), born at Bone Gap, nothing known. In 1900 the family (without the sons EDSON or PARLEY) was living at Bone Gap, Edwards County (ED 16, Sheet 12) Illinois. Also living with them was a niece, Lila HARRIS, born Nov 1880 at Illinois. In 1920 the parents, single son WILBUR and a niece, Iva HOCKING (age 19, born IL) were living at Cleveland Township, Clay County, Page 17, ED2, Sheet 7, Arkansas. Other records show Eliza was born 02 Feb 1857. Which is correct? If anyone has any information to trade on this family please contact me. Dan_Stevenson@sparta.com

    1. Sergt. GILBERT E. HOCKING
    2. This is a Message Board Post that is gatewayed to this mailing list. Classification: Query Message Board URL: http://boards.ancestry.co.uk/mbexec/msg/5538/TSj.2ACIB/124 Message Board Post: Can anyone help me trace relations of my grandfather .GILBERT E.( for Edward?) HOCKING , Sergeant, Royal Army Service Corps a newspaper account of whose funeral I have found among papers left by my mother.: BORN - about 1879 , native of St. Enoder, Cornwall YOUNGEST SON OF - Captain and Mrs Edward Hocking of Retew DIED - Friday, 22nd April, 1921 aged 42, at Military Hospital, Devonport. BURIED - on 26th April 1921 at Plymouth, Stonehouse and Devonport Cemetery, with full military honours. (Coffin draped in Union Jack conveyed on R.A.S.C.gun carriage from New Granby Barracks drawn by 4 black horses preceded by the band of the Royal Garrison Artillery (Citadel), 3 volleys fired over grave and "last Post"sounded), WIFE'S NAME - Charlotte (nee Peabody?). Irish. Died in Dublin15th Dec. 1957. FOUR CHILDREN - Adeline Phyllis (my mother), Leslie, Edward, Marian - all deceased. LIVED IN DUBLIN for 17 years before being transferred to DevonportT ten months before his death. Had apparently travelled frequently to Africa on military duties. MOURNERS AT FUNERAL included Capt. E HOCKING (father), Mr J. HOCKING (brother), Mrs A. KESSELL (sister), Mr W. TREMBATH and Mrs NORGROVE (brother-in-law and friend).. An ALAN TREMBATH was also frequently mentioned by my mother. Why he was accorded full military honours is not known to me. Any information would be appreciated. My e-mail address is gaughran@verbier.ch
